ABSTRACT / PROJECT SUMMARY
A major purpose of a Phase III COBRE is to implement and administer a Pilot Projects Program to
select pilot projects that will utilize existing COBRE Core Labs and generate preliminary results in
support of proposals to secure extramural funding. This COBRE will continue to develop a highly
successful , proven program for supporting Pilot Projects. The Center leadership will solicit pilot
project proposals, obtain scientifically rigorous external reviews of all applications, and consulting with
our External Advisory Committee, will fund up to four of the most meritorious projects annually. Each
selected pilot project award may be funded for a second year subject to satisfactory progress. The
Pilot Project Program will also serve as a means to enhance communication and increase
collaboration within the developmental biology research community at KUMC. An annual
Developmental Biology Symposium is planned to promote participation by a broad range of
investigators in the Center and will feature speakers from among the Pilot Project Lead Investigators
and their respective Mentors. To assess the impact of the Pilot Grants Program on career development
and use this information to modify and improve the program, we will obtain follow-up data on all
successful and unsuccessful applicants and determine the impact of pilot grants by measuring the
number of publications, level of extramural funding, and promotions in academic rank/responsibility.
We will also assess the impact on the broader research community through survey mechanisms
and document the degree of collaboration. This information will then be used to improve the Pilot
Program through a process of re-evaluation of practices and program modification.
